PM Modi to inaugurate Sustainable Development Summit 2021

NEW DELHI: Prime Minister Narendra Modi will inaugurate the World Sustainable Summit 2021 on February 10 via video conferencing. The theme of the summit this year is ‘Redefining our common future: Safe and secure environment for all’.

Important delegates who will participate in the event include Dr Mohamed Irfaan Ali, President, Cooperative Republic of Guyana; James Marape, Prime Minister, Government of Papua New Guinea; Mohamed Nasheed, Speaker of the People’s Majlis, Republic of Maldives; and Prakash Javadekar, Minister of Forest, Environment and Climate Change, Government of India. The twentieth edition of The Energy and Resources Institute (TERI) flagship event, the World Sustainable Development Summit, will be held online between February 10 and February 12.

The event will bring together numerous governments, business leaders, academicians, climate scientists, youth and civil societies in their fight against climate change. Ministry of Forest, Environment and Climate Change and Ministry of Earth Sciences, Government of India, are key partners of the event.
